Why Wawel Castle is Special
Wawel Castle sits atop Wawel Hill, overlooking the Vistula River. For centuries it served as the residence of Polish kings and the political heart of the nation. Its Renaissance courtyards, Gothic cathedral, and fortified walls form a dramatic silhouette above the water.
The River Perspective
From the deck of a private boat, the castle appears in its full majesty, rising above tree-lined boulevards. This view emphasizes both its defensive position and its symbolic role as a cultural landmark. Unlike street-level perspectives, the river reveals the castle’s broad expanse against the Krakow skyline.
Best Times to Experience the Panorama
- Daytime Cruises: Highlight the architectural details, golden stone walls, and green surroundings.
- Sunset Cruises: The castle glows in warm light, making a Krakow sunset cruise one of the most romantic experiences available.
- Evening Cruises: Illuminated floodlights transform the fortress into a glowing landmark reflecting in the Vistula.
